Output d5f28b4d767417a6b24b9979753fe6ac951783391f3fade19593b30d3319cf7a:0

value
2116936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d484c03715425e167a0d70964029ad22522e05 OP_EQUAL
address
3Di52ipRzmvmbS21p35fYRDaXvuzRF19pr
transaction
d5f28b4d767417a6b24b9979753fe6ac951783391f3fade19593b30d3319cf7a
confirmations
514782
spent
true